8-K: Eagle Nuclear Energy Corp. Q2 2026 Update

Sentiment:

Quarterly Update


Eagle Nuclear Energy Corp. reports on advancements in its Aurora Uranium Project and SMR technology for Q2 2026, highlighting progress towards a Pre-Feasibility Study and strategic partnerships.

Summary

  • Eagle Nuclear Energy Corp. provided a corporate update for the second quarter ending May 31, 2026, detailing progress on its Aurora Uranium Project and Small Modular Reactor (SMR) technology.
  • The Aurora Uranium Project, described as the largest conventional, measured, and indicated uranium deposit in the US, is advancing towards a Pre-Feasibility Study (PFS) targeted for completion in late 2027.
  • Key activities during the quarter included environmental and site-readiness initiatives at Aurora, such as meteorological station installation, wetland delineation, and cultural surveys, in preparation for the PFS-related drill program.
  • The company engaged with government bodies like the Uranium Producers of America and the U.S. Department of Energy to discuss domestic uranium production needs.
  • In its SMR program, Eagle partnered with Tensor Medium Corporation to leverage AI-enabled reactor modeling and simulation for optimizing SMR design.
  • As of May 31, 2026, the company reported a cash balance of $28.1 million and no outstanding interest-bearing debt.
  • Eagle announced partnerships with Yukuskon Professional Services, LLC, BBA USA Inc., and SLR International Corporation to support the Aurora drill program and PFS progression.

Negatives

  • The Pre-Feasibility Study for the Aurora Project is not scheduled for completion until late 2027, indicating a long development timeline.
  • The company is still in the early stages of SMR technology development, with significant R&D and commercialization hurdles ahead.
  • Reliance on third-party contractors and service providers introduces potential execution risks.
